Introducción del producto

This VOC filter contains virgin coconut-shell or coal-based activated carbon selected for non-polar organic vapours. The adsorbent is packed into a rigid V-bank or box cell to combine a large media mass with practical airflow. Internal screens and seals eliminate edge bypass and limit carbon fines. It is commonly preceded by particulate filtration so dust does not block the carbon pores, and it may be followed by a final filter where product cleanliness is critical.

Características clave

Microporous activated carbon provides a broad adsorption surface for many organic vapours.

A deep or V-bank bed carries substantially more adsorbent than a thin carbon pad.

Internal media screens reduce carbon migration into the downstream system.

Gasketed frame interfaces suit front- or side-access filter housings.

Preocupaciones del producto del cliente

Low-boiling solvents and process VOCs pass through particle filters and may contaminate products or create persistent odour.

A carbon-coated pad saturates quickly during routine solvent use.A deep bed increases usable carbon mass and extends the adsorption interval.
High humidity occupies adsorption sites and shortens filter life.Media grade and airflow residence time are selected for the expected humidity and VOC family.
Dust loads the carbon surface before it can adsorb vapour.An upstream fine-particle stage protects pores and preserves molecular capacity.
Unsealed filter edges let untreated air bypass the media bed.Continuous gaskets and bonded internal joints close the frame-to-housing path.

Parámetros técnicos

Common construction ranges for a deep-bed VOC molecular filter are listed below.

Materiales CoreVirgin activated carbon selected for hydrocarbons, solvents and broad-spectrum VOC adsorption
Panel de espesor150–292 mm overall filter depth
Ancho efectivo305 - 610 mm Ancho nominal de cara
Longitud máximaUp to 762 mm nominal face height
Acero frente a espesor0.7–1.2 mm galvanized or stainless-steel frame and retainers
Densidad Core420–560 kg/m³ packed activated-carbon bulk density
Conductividad térmica0.09–0.18 W/(m·K) for packed activated carbon
Superficie acabadaGalvanized steel, brushed stainless steel or low-emission powder coat
Tipo conjuntoSealed deep-bed or V-bank cell with continuous polyurethane or neoprene gasket
